- 1、本文档共3页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
Excel在水文数据数字修约中的应用.pdf
垦勘建 数据_ttm_j数鲁修绚卿
◎马 锋
1数字修整的目的与意义 公式 :“=A12”则 Bl显示结果为 2.2INT()函数
4.69。即引用的数值仍为原来的数值 INT()函数为将数字向下舍人到最
在测量和数字计算中,小数点后 2.354,并非 2.35。但是如果按照四舍六 接近的整数。
应用几位数字来表示被测量或计算的 人,逢五奇进偶不进修约规则 ,则应该 语法 :INT (number),Number需要
结果,是一个很重要的问题。并不是一 是 2.34×2=4.68。两者显然有所差别。 进行向下舍人取整的实数。
个数值中小数点后面的数愈多,这个 为了使水文数据在Excel中的处 例 1:同样的方法可对 A1乘 以
数值就愈精确;或者在计算结果中,保 理符合水文规范要求 ,必须在Excel中 100,向下取整,再除以100。将数值扩
留的位数愈多,这个数就愈精确。在保 编辑函数公式,实现计算机计算代替 大多少倍,处理后再缩小相应的倍数,
证精度的前提下,为了计算的方便 ,引 手工计算。达到既高效又精确的目的。 这种思路在各种函数公式中都会用到。
进了有效数字的概念。水文测验中不 例 2:
同的要素的观测值有不同的有效数字 2水文数据处理常用函数简介 =INT (8.9) 将 8.9向下舍人到
取位,即便同一种要素 ,在不同的量级 最接近的整数 (8)
时也会有不同的有效数字取位。 2.1IFf)函数 =INT(一8.9)将8.9向下舍入到
与有效数字相配套的是数字的修 IF()函数根据对指定的条件计算 最接近的整数 (一9)
约,在许多领域,惯用四舍五人法对多 结果为 TRUE(真)或 FALSE(假),返 2.3MOD()函数
余的尾数进行修约。为了尽量减少数 回不同的结果。可以使用 IF对数值和 返回两数相除的余数。结果的正
字修约造成的舍入误差 ,使水文测验、 公式执行条件检测。 负号与除数相同。
资料整编成果更加精确 ,水文测验和 语 法 :IF (1ogical_test,value— 语 法 :MOD (number,divisor),即
IF true,value IF
资料整编规范对水文数据的修约作出 _ — — false),公式可这样理 MOD(被除数,被除数)
如下规定 :四舍六人 ,逢五奇进偶不 解 IF(条件 ,条件成立时返回的值 ,条 函数 MOD可以借用函数 INT来
进。限于上述数字修约的规定,流量测 件不成立时返回的值)。 表不:MOD(n,d)=n—dINT(n/d)
验计算表等在每一步的计算过程都必 例 1:在单元格 B1中输入公式 : 示例:
须人工修约,比较麻烦 ,而且容易出现 = IF(Al=60,“及格”,“不及格”)。 =MOD(3,2) 32/的余数(1)
差错。计算机的应用,可以大幅度地减 此时条件为:Al=60,如果单元格 : MOD(3,一2)3,_2的余数,符号
少人工计算工作量 。但 是 ,使用 A1的数值大于或等于60,说明条件成 与除数的相同(一1)
MicrosoftExcel计算时,其修约方式是 立,B1单元格显示:“及格”,如果单元 =
文档评论(0)